There, I said it. “But, Abby,” you’re thinking. “How could you not like pets? They’re adorable. They’re loyal. They provide countless hours of subject matter for ridiculous YouTube videos.”

Yes, I realize that. It’s just that growing up, I never really had pets. Sure, I had a goldfish named Fishy that I swear we owned for four or five years (although my childhood memory may be a bit dusty.) And at one point, I decided Fishy needed friends so we went to the pet shop on the upper level of local grocery store and bought him a castle and a family. And then, all of them died. So that’s the extent of my pet-owning experience.

It’s not that I don’t like pets. I’ve been known to snuggle with a distant cousin-by-marriage’s blue-eyed Canadian Husky named Strawberry, pet a sweet Golden Retriever named Cinca who casually wandered the offices of the Barberton Herald when I worked there in the ‘90s, and let out my in-laws’ two Chocolate Labs when they’re out of town.

But, kind of like the singles we featured in last month’s Single in the City cover story, when it comes to pets, I haven’t found “the one” yet, and it reminds me of a quote by author Anatole France: “Until one has loved an animal, a part of one’s soul remains unawakened.”

Several of my friends volunteer with pet rescues, and I look at the pictures they post on Facebook of pets who need a “forever home” and wonder if any of them could possibly be “the one.” I’m sure my husband and kids would love for us to get a dog, but the thing is, I don’t know if I’m ready to be a pet owner yet. (Honestly, after all these years, I’m still getting used to being a mom.)

Maybe once my kids are older, I’ll consider a pet for our home.
